Recently, Microsoft released a security bulletin describing a vulnerability
that can be exploited by a specially crafted PDF file attached to a regular
email. Since Windows Malware Protection Engine software scans incoming files
automatically, the attack could succeed even if the targeted victim does not
interact with the malicious PDF file.
This particular vulnerability may also be exploited by hosting his malicious
PDF file on a Web site.
You should download and apply all Microsoft security patches immediately and
make sure your anti virus software is up to date.

Hi everyone,
Sorry for the OT, but is anyone else receiving a large amount of PDF
attachments via their Amsat email alias?
Countless variations of the 'Greeting Card' PDF have been cluttering my
inbox lately, mostly via my Amsat
alias address. I do use a SPAM filter, and it is probably catching 70%, so
you can imagine how much junk is coming in!
Is this just affecting me, or do we need to ratchet up the SPAM filtering on
the Amsat server?
